Strengths & limits

In its favour
  • Excellent piano/e-piano sounds for the class
  • Deliberately simple operation – ideal for adults
  • Light (4.5 kg), battery operation possible
Against it
  • No auto accompaniment, no display – for entertainer features take the PSR
  • Keys unweighted

Technical data

Action 61 keys, touch-sensitive
Sound engine AiX-Klangerzeugung
Polyphony 64-voice
Amplification 2× 2.5 W
Weight 4,5 kg
Connections USB-MIDI, headphones, Sustain, Audio In; battery operation possible
Features 61 hochwertige voices, minimalist design without a display, strap pins
